Difference between revisions of "Sales.StoreSurveySchemaCollection (xml schema collection)"
Line 2: | Line 2: | ||
{| border="1" cellpadding="5" cellspacing="0" style="border-collapse:collapse" | {| border="1" cellpadding="5" cellspacing="0" style="border-collapse:collapse" | ||
− | |- | + | |- valign="top" |
| '''XML Schema Collection | | '''XML Schema Collection | ||
| Sales.StoreSurveySchemaCollection | | Sales.StoreSurveySchemaCollection | ||
Line 8: | Line 8: | ||
| '''Description | | '''Description | ||
| Collection of XML schemas for the Demographics column in the Sales.Store table. | | Collection of XML schemas for the Demographics column in the Sales.Store table. | ||
− | |||
|} | |} | ||
− | |||
=== Source === | === Source === | ||
Line 87: | Line 85: | ||
| '''Referenced Object | | '''Referenced Object | ||
− | |- | + | |- valign="top" |
| Schema | | Schema | ||
| Schema | | Schema | ||
Line 101: | Line 99: | ||
| '''Referencing Object | | '''Referencing Object | ||
− | |- | + | |- valign="top" |
| Data Type | | Data Type | ||
| Table | | Table |
Latest revision as of 00:17, 24 June 2010
wikibot[edit]
XML Schema Collection | Sales.StoreSurveySchemaCollection |
Description | Collection of XML schemas for the Demographics column in the Sales.Store table. |
Source[edit]
<?xml version="1.0" encoding="utf-8"?> <xsd:schema xmlns:xsd="http://www.w3.org/2001/XMLSchema" xmlns:t="http://schemas.microsoft.com/sqlserver/2004/07/adventure-works/StoreSurvey" targetNamespace="http://schemas.microsoft.com/sqlserver/2004/07/adventure-works/StoreSurvey" elementFormDefault="qualified"> <xsd:element name="StoreSurvey"> <xsd:complexType> <xsd:complexContent> <xsd:restriction base="xsd:anyType"> <xsd:sequence> <xsd:element name="ContactName" type="xsd:string" minOccurs="0" /> <xsd:element name="JobTitle" type="xsd:string" minOccurs="0" /> <xsd:element name="AnnualSales" type="xsd:decimal" minOccurs="0" /> <xsd:element name="AnnualRevenue" type="xsd:decimal" minOccurs="0" /> <xsd:element name="BankName" type="xsd:string" minOccurs="0" /> <xsd:element name="BusinessType" type="t:BusinessType" minOccurs="0" /> <xsd:element name="YearOpened" type="xsd:gYear" minOccurs="0" /> <xsd:element name="Specialty" type="t:SpecialtyType" minOccurs="0" /> <xsd:element name="SquareFeet" type="xsd:float" minOccurs="0" /> <xsd:element name="Brands" type="t:BrandType" minOccurs="0" /> <xsd:element name="Internet" type="t:InternetType" minOccurs="0" /> <xsd:element name="NumberEmployees" type="xsd:int" minOccurs="0" /> <xsd:element name="Comments" type="xsd:string" minOccurs="0" /> </xsd:sequence> </xsd:restriction> </xsd:complexContent> </xsd:complexType> </xsd:element> <xsd:simpleType name="BrandType"> <xsd:restriction base="xsd:string"> <xsd:enumeration value="AW" /> <xsd:enumeration value="2" /> <xsd:enumeration value="3" /> <xsd:enumeration value="4+" /> </xsd:restriction> </xsd:simpleType> <xsd:simpleType name="BusinessType"> <xsd:restriction base="xsd:string"> <xsd:enumeration value="BM" /> <xsd:enumeration value="BS" /> <xsd:enumeration value="D" /> <xsd:enumeration value="OS" /> <xsd:enumeration value="SGS" /> </xsd:restriction> </xsd:simpleType> <xsd:simpleType name="InternetType"> <xsd:restriction base="xsd:string"> <xsd:enumeration value="56kb" /> <xsd:enumeration value="ISDN" /> <xsd:enumeration value="DSL" /> <xsd:enumeration value="T1" /> <xsd:enumeration value="T2" /> <xsd:enumeration value="T3" /> </xsd:restriction> </xsd:simpleType> <xsd:simpleType name="SpecialtyType"> <xsd:restriction base="xsd:string"> <xsd:enumeration value="Family" /> <xsd:enumeration value="Kids" /> <xsd:enumeration value="BMX" /> <xsd:enumeration value="Touring" /> <xsd:enumeration value="Road" /> <xsd:enumeration value="Mountain" /> <xsd:enumeration value="All" /> </xsd:restriction> </xsd:simpleType> </xsd:schema>
References[edit]
Dependency Type | Object Type | Referenced Object |
Schema | Schema | Sales |
Dependencies[edit]
Reference Type | Object Type | Referencing Object |
Data Type | Table | Sales.Store |
automatically generated[edit]
xmlschemacollection | Sales.StoreSurveySchemaCollection |
Description | Collection of XML schemas for the Demographics column in the Sales.Store table. |
<?xml version="1.0" encoding="UTF-8"?> <xsd:schema xmlns:xsd="http://www.w3.org/2001/XMLSchema" targetNamespace="http://schemas.microsoft.com/sqlserver/2004/07/adventure-works/StoreSurvey" xmlns="http://schemas.microsoft.com/sqlserver/2004/07/adventure-works/StoreSurvey" elementFormDefault="qualified" attributeFormDefault="unqualified"> <!-- BM=Bicycle manu BS=bicyle store OS=online store SGS=sporting goods store D=Discount Store --> <xsd:simpleType name="BusinessType"> <xsd:restriction base="xsd:string"> <xsd:enumeration value="BM" /> <xsd:enumeration value="BS" /> <xsd:enumeration value="D" /> <xsd:enumeration value="OS" /> <xsd:enumeration value="SGS" /> </xsd:restriction> </xsd:simpleType> <!-- BMX=BMX Racing --> <xsd:simpleType name="SpecialtyType"> <xsd:restriction base="xsd:string"> <xsd:enumeration value="Family" /> <xsd:enumeration value="Kids" /> <xsd:enumeration value="BMX" /> <xsd:enumeration value="Touring" /> <xsd:enumeration value="Road" /> <xsd:enumeration value="Mountain" /> <xsd:enumeration value="All" /> </xsd:restriction> </xsd:simpleType> <!-- AW=AdventureWorks only 2= AdvWorks+1 other brand other brand --> <xsd:simpleType name="BrandType"> <xsd:restriction base="xsd:string"> <xsd:enumeration value="AW" /> <xsd:enumeration value="2" /> <xsd:enumeration value="3" /> <xsd:enumeration value="4+" /> </xsd:restriction> </xsd:simpleType> <xsd:simpleType name="InternetType"> <xsd:restriction base="xsd:string"> <xsd:enumeration value="56kb" /> <xsd:enumeration value="ISDN" /> <xsd:enumeration value="DSL" /> <xsd:enumeration value="T1" /> <xsd:enumeration value="T2" /> <xsd:enumeration value="T3" /> </xsd:restriction> </xsd:simpleType> <xsd:element name="StoreSurvey"> <xsd:complexType> <xsd:sequence> <xsd:element name="ContactName" type="xsd:string" minOccurs="0" maxOccurs="1" /> <xsd:element name="JobTitle" type="xsd:string" minOccurs="0" maxOccurs="1" /> <xsd:element name="AnnualSales" type="xsd:decimal" minOccurs="0" maxOccurs="1" /> <xsd:element name="AnnualRevenue" type="xsd:decimal" minOccurs="0" maxOccurs="1" /> <xsd:element name="BankName" type="xsd:string" minOccurs="0" maxOccurs="1" /> <xsd:element name="BusinessType" type="BusinessType" minOccurs="0" maxOccurs="1" /> <xsd:element name="YearOpened" type="xsd:gYear" minOccurs="0" maxOccurs="1" /> <xsd:element name="Specialty" type="SpecialtyType" minOccurs="0" maxOccurs="1" /> <xsd:element name="SquareFeet" type="xsd:float" minOccurs="0" maxOccurs="1" /> <xsd:element name="Brands" type="BrandType" minOccurs="0" maxOccurs="1" /> <xsd:element name="Internet" type="InternetType" minOccurs="0" maxOccurs="1" /> <xsd:element name="NumberEmployees" type="xsd:int" minOccurs="0" maxOccurs="1" /> <xsd:element name="Comments" type="xsd:string" minOccurs="0" maxOccurs="1" /> </xsd:sequence> </xsd:complexType> </xsd:element> </xsd:schema>
Dependency Type | Object Type | Referenced Object |
Schema | Schema | Sales |
Reference Type | Object Type | Referencing Object |
Data Type | Table | Sales.Store |